Output 172824aeee1602eef6b36c5a855667d8051504f4023e2da1d825a66391764c38:9

value
3185680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 049728fbfb0ae008f89e916b6934a8a14800577d OP_EQUAL
address
327Hi6fw4TjaDP3dwjzCwDCXGdfpfuCvGP
transaction
172824aeee1602eef6b36c5a855667d8051504f4023e2da1d825a66391764c38
confirmations
272512
spent
true